What breed of dog can live in a flat?
1. Havanese. “Lively, affectionate and intelligent, a Havanese is a small breed which would be at home in a flat or small house. They love to be with their owners, so if you can take your dog to work or you are at home for most of the day, a Havanese could be the breed for you,” explains Caroline.

Can a small dog live in a flat?
Generally, the smaller the dog, the better it’s suited to life in a flat. Make sure it has plenty of toys to keep its mind stimulated, and ensure you give it plenty of exercise.

What pets can you have in a flat?
They suggest the best pets for flats include:
- Hamsters, rats, gerbils and mice.
- Guinea pigs and rabbits.
- Fish, reptiles, birds, small cats and dogs are also happy to live in a flat environment. Although small birds don’t need much space, they can be noisy which is something landlords should consider before accepting them.
Can you get a puppy in flat?
The short answer is, it all depends on the dog. The amount of exercise and space a dog requires depends on the breed. The pet sale website Pets4Homes advises users that keeping a dog in a flat is entirely possible, as long as prospective owners consider factors such as barking and how calm a particular breed is.
